Exploring the Sistine Chapel

Venture into the majestic Sistine Chapel to witness Michelangelo’s awe-inspiring masterpieces firsthand.
The Chapel is a treasure trove of artistic masterpieces, showcasing Michelangelo’s genius through iconic works like the ceiling frescoes and ‘The Last Judgment.’
The intricate details and vibrant colors of the artwork will leave visitors in awe of the artist’s skill and vision.
As you gaze up at the ceiling, you’ll see the famous depiction of God giving life to Adam, a truly breathtaking sight.

Is There a Dress Code for Visiting the Vatican and Other Religious Sites?
When visiting the Vatican and other religious sites, it is important to adhere to a dress code. Appropriate attire typically includes covering shoulders and knees. Respectful clothing choices are crucial to ensure a smooth and respectful visit.
